Choosing the Right AI Agent for Your Customer Service Needs

Selecting the ideal AI agent for your small business customer support involves understanding various types and their capabilities. Not all AI agents are created equal, and the "best" one depends entirely on your specific requirements and budget. You'll typically encounter three main categories: rule-based chatbots, intent-based chatbots (or Natural Language Understanding - NLU bots), and more advanced conversational AI agents. Rule-based bots are the simplest, following predefined scripts and keywords, best for FAQs and structured interactions. Intent-based bots, however, can understand user intent despite variations in phrasing, offering more flexible and intelligent interactions. Conversational AI goes a step further, maintaining context across multiple turns and offering a more human-like dialogue.

When making your choice, consider crucial factors such as integration capabilities with your existing CRM or helpdesk software, ease of customization to match your brand voice and specific workflows, and the agent's learning capabilities – can it improve over time with more data? Cost is another significant factor; many platforms offer tiered pricing suitable for small businesses. For example, a small e-commerce store might start with an intent-based bot for order tracking and product inquiries, while a service-based business might prioritize a conversational AI that can pre-qualify leads or schedule appointments. A careful assessment of your most common customer queries will guide you towards the most impactful and cost-effective solution.

Comparison of AI Agent Types for Small Businesses
Feature Rule-Based Chatbot Intent-Based Chatbot Conversational AI Agent
Complexity Low Medium High
Use Cases Simple FAQs, defined flows FAQs, troubleshooting, lead qualification Complex dialogues, personalized interactions, task completion
Key Advantage Easy to set up, predictable Understands user intent, more flexible Human-like interaction, remembers context
Cost (Initial) Low Medium High
Maintenance Low-Medium (rule updates) Medium (model training) High (continuous learning & optimization)
Integration Basic (web widget) Good (APIs for CRM, ticketing) Excellent (deep CRM, ERP, custom systems)

Step-by-Step: Implementing AI Agents Without Breaking the Bank

Implementing AI automation for customer support small business doesn't require a Silicon Valley budget or an army of data scientists. A strategic, phased approach can yield significant results without overextending your resources. Here’s a practical guide to deploying AI agents cost-effectively:

  1. Define Your Scope and Start Small: Don't try to automate everything at once. Identify your most frequent and repetitive customer inquiries (e.g., "What are your hours?", "How do I track my order?", "What's your return policy?"). Start with an AI agent that can handle 70-80% of these simple, high-volume questions. This creates a quick proof of concept and demonstrates immediate value.
  2. Choose a Cost-Effective Platform: Many AI agent builders now cater to small businesses. Look for platforms offering intuitive drag-and-drop interfaces, pre-built templates, and tiered pricing plans. Options like ManyChat, Zoho SalesIQ, or even specific integrations within CRM systems (e.g., HubSpot chatbots) can be excellent starting points, often with free tiers or low monthly fees.
  3. Gather and Train Your AI Agent with Relevant Data: The quality of your AI agent is directly proportional to the quality of its training data. Compile your existing FAQs, help articles, and transcripts of common customer service interactions. Use these to train your bot on how to answer questions accurately and in your brand's voice. Many platforms allow you to input question variations to improve Natural Language Processing (NLP).
  4. Pilot Test Internally, Then Externally: Before a full launch, run internal pilot tests with your team. Have them ask questions, try to "break" the bot, and identify areas for improvement. Once refined, conduct a soft launch with a small group of customers or on a specific page of your website. Gather feedback and iterate quickly.
  5. Iterate, Expand, and Learn Continuously: AI agents are not "set it and forget it." Regularly review conversations, identify questions the bot couldn't answer, and use this data to refine its knowledge base and responses. As your business grows and your needs evolve, you can gradually expand the AI agent's capabilities to handle more complex scenarios or integrate with additional systems. This iterative development ensures long-term value.

Overcoming Challenges and Maximizing ROI with AI Agents

While the promise of AI automation for customer support small business is immense, successful implementation isn't without its challenges. Understanding and proactively addressing these hurdles is key to maximizing your return on investment (ROI). Common pitfalls include poor AI training, neglecting the human element, and inadequate integration with existing systems.

One significant challenge is ensuring the AI agent's knowledge base is comprehensive and up-to-date. An AI agent that frequently says "I don't understand" or provides inaccurate information can quickly frustrate customers. This can be overcome through meticulous initial training with high-quality data and a commitment to continuous learning. Regularly review interactions, identify conversational gaps, and update the AI's responses and understanding. Tools that highlight "unanswered questions" are invaluable here.

Another crucial aspect is the balance between automation and human interaction. AI agents should augment, not replace, human support. A lack of a clear human fallback or a clunky handoff process can severely damage the customer experience. Implement a robust human-in-the-loop strategy where complex or sensitive issues are seamlessly escalated to a live agent, providing context from the AI interaction. This ensures customers always have a path to human assistance when needed, building trust and satisfaction.

Finally, ensure your AI agent integrates smoothly with your existing CRM, helpdesk, or other business tools. Fragmented systems can lead to inefficient workflows and data silos. Invest in platforms with strong API capabilities or seek solutions that offer native integrations. This seamless connectivity not only improves efficiency but also provides a holistic view of the customer journey, enabling personalized and proactive support. By addressing these challenges head-on, small businesses can truly unlock the full potential of AI agents, turning potential frustrations into opportunities for enhanced service and significant ROI.
